Untitled (Eleanor Duse)

जोसेफ कॉर्नल (1903 – 1972)

जोसेफ कॉर्नल (1903-1972) एक अमेरिकी कलाकार थे जो अपनी काव्यात्मक शैडो बॉक्स और प्रायोगिक फिल्मों के लिए प्रसिद्ध हैं। उनके सुर्रियल असेंबलज कला और स्मृति, उदासीनता और अवचेतन विषयों की खोज ने आधुनिक कला को प्रभावित किया।

The Smithsonian American Art Museum is home to a fascinating piece by Joseph Cornell, titled Untitled (Eleanor Duse). This 1960 collage is a quintessential representation of Cornell's unique style, which often blended elements of surrealism and abstract expressionism. As a masterpiece of modern art, it continues to intrigue audiences with its mysterious and dreamlike quality.

The Artist's Inspiration

Joseph Cornell was an American artist known for his innovative use of collage and assemblage techniques. His works often featured found objects and vintage photographs, which he would carefully arrange to create intricate, layered compositions. In the case of Untitled (Eleanor Duse), Cornell drew inspiration from the Italian actress Eleanor Duse, who was renowned for her captivating stage presence.

Key Elements and Symbolism

The collage features a black and white photograph of a woman, presumably Eleanor Duse, set against a backdrop of subtle, muted colors. The image is accompanied by two other figures in the background, adding a sense of depth and context to the scene. Cornell's use of collage and mixed media techniques creates a captivating visual narrative, inviting viewers to ponder the meaning behind the artwork.
